Product Support Specialist, Regulatory Reporting - India

Permanent employee, Full-time · Pune

What you'll do
Do you thrive on helping customers succeed and love turning challenges into solutions? As a Product Support Specialist for our regulatory reporting solutions, you’ll be the trusted advisor our clients rely on — guiding them through product features, resolving inquiries, and ensuring they maximize value from our offerings. This is your chance to deepen your expertise in financial and regulatory workflows while growing with a global team — with an on-site setup in Pune, India 
 
Key Responsibilities:  
 
Business and Functional Troubleshooting  
 
  • Serve as a trusted advisor for clients using our regulatory reporting products, resolving functionalinquiriesand guiding best practices.  
  • Analyze and troubleshoot business rules and configurations to resolve issues effectively. 
  • Investigate discrepancies in regulatory calculations, collaborating with internal teams to deliver solutions. 
  • Collaborate with technical teams to ensure comprehensive issue resolution. 
  • Hands over to 3rd Line Support if an issue requires deeper investigation, following standard escalation procedures.
Global Incident Handling:  
 

  • Participate in a 24x7 rotating on-call schedule to provide contractual support, which includes mandatory availability during weekends, holidays, andoutside ofstandard business hours.
  • Ensure seamless handover and coordination with other regions as part of the Follow the Sun support model. 
  • Support response efforts for high-priority or platform-wide incidents,maintainingclear internal communication and documentation. 
  • Ensure properrecording, tracking, and closure of all issues according to defined procedures.

Why we should decide on you
  •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Business Administration, Economics or a related field (preferred, but strong experience may substitute).  
  • 2-4 years of hands-on professional experience in a techno-functional capacity, such as application support or business analysis, preferably for a financial software product. 
  • Knowledge of regulatory reporting workflows (e.g. Basel IV, SGMAS, HKMA, APRA, IFRS, QI, FATCA, CRS) is highly valued.  
  • A foundational understanding of relational databases (e.g., Oracle, SQL Server) and data modeling concepts, with the ability to read basic SQL queries for troubleshooting and analysis is highly valued.  
  • Experience with financial reporting software and understanding of business workflows.  
  • Strong analytical skills with a high affinity for numbers and cross-functional collaboration.  
  • Excellent communication skills in English, both written and verbal.  
  • Experience with agile methods (Scrum) is a plus.  
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Excel; familiarity with ticketing systems is a plus.  
  • Location: Pune, India  

Note: Candidates without prior regulatory reporting experience but with strong product support skills and a willingness to learn are encouraged to apply.

About Regnology

Regnology is a recognised leader in regulatory, risk, tax, finance reporting as well as supervisory technology, connecting regulators and the regulated across more than 100 countries.

Serving Tier 1 banks, regional institutions, corporates, insurers, and authorities, our modular, cloud-native platform delivers trusted compliance, innovation, and future-ready solutions—empowering clients with global reach, local expertise, and proven leadership.
